We’re looking for a Customer Success Manager to build and scale our customer success function from the ground up - turning early wins into repeatable success and expansion.

As our first dedicated Customer Success Manager, you will define and own the post-sales motion for Nominal. You will be responsible for ensuring our customers achieve rapid value, drive ongoing product adoption, secure renewals, and expand revenue through upsells and cross-sells. You will work hand-in-hand with our technical onboarding team, product team, and engineering to shape how customers use our platform and to scale the CS process as Nominal grows.

Responsibilities and Impact

  • Own the full customer lifecycle post-go-live: onboarding, adoption, renewal, and expansion.
  • Develop success plans with customers to ensure measurable business outcomes.
  • Monitor customer health metrics and usage signals; proactively engage to mitigate churn risk and promote growth opportunities.
  • Manage a revenue target tied to renewals and expansion (upsells and cross-sells);
  • Work with customers to identify manual accounting processes and translate them into Nominal automation opportunities.
  • Work closely with our technical implementation team to ensure seamless hand-off of agentic workflows from implementation into success, and ongoing value delivery.
  • Work closely with the Product team: gather and synthesize customer feedback, identify feature gaps, inform roadmap priorities.
  • Define and document CS playbooks, processes, metrics, and tooling (e.g., health scoring, dashboards, playbooks for expansions).
  • Lead regular business reviews with customers (quarterly, executive), tracking value delivered and renewing/expanding contracts.
  • Champion customer advocacy: case studies, references, testimonials, and user-community development.

What you need to know about the Seattle Tech Scene

Home to tech titans like Microsoft and Amazon, Seattle punches far above its weight in innovation. But its surrounding mountains, sprinkled with world-famous hiking trails and climbing routes, make the city a destination for outdoorsy types as well. Established as a logging town before shifting to shipbuilding and logistics, the Emerald City is now known for its contributions to aerospace, software, biotech and cloud computing. And its status as a thriving tech ecosystem is attracting out-of-town companies looking to establish new tech and engineering hubs.

Key Facts About Seattle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 287,000; 13%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Amazon, Microsoft, Meta, Google
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, cloud computing, software, biotechnology, game development
  • Funding Landscape: $3.1 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Madrona, Fuse, Tola, Maveron
  • Research Centers and Universities: University of Washington, Seattle University, Seattle Pacific University, Allen Institute for Brain Science, Bill & Melinda Gates Foundation, Seattle Children’s Research Institute
